MySQL下载安装后,找不到bin文件?解决指南来了!
mysql下载后找不到bin文件

首页 2025-07-11 15:18:54



MySQL下载后找不到bin文件?别急,这里有你需要的全面指南! 在数据库管理领域,MySQL无疑是一个强大的工具,广泛应用于各种Web应用和服务器环境中

    然而,在安装和使用MySQL的过程中,不少用户会遇到一个问题:下载并安装MySQL后,却找不到关键的`bin`文件夹

    这不仅让初学者感到困惑,即便是经验丰富的开发者也可能一时不知所措

    别担心,本文将为你提供一份详尽的指南,帮助你迅速找到并解决这一问题

     一、理解MySQL的安装结构 首先,我们需要明确MySQL的安装结构

    MySQL的安装目录通常包含多个子文件夹,其中`bin`文件夹尤为重要,因为它包含了MySQL的主要可执行文件,如`mysqld`(MySQL服务器)、`mysql`(MySQL客户端)、`mysqladmin`等

    这些工具是管理和操作MySQL数据库的基础

     二、常见安装场景分析 MySQL的安装方式多样,包括通过官方安装包、第三方软件包管理器(如APT、YUM)、ZIP压缩包等

    不同安装方式下,`bin`文件夹的位置可能会有所不同

    下面,我们将逐一分析这些场景

     1.官方安装包 如果你通过MySQL官方网站下载并安装了MySQL,安装过程通常会引导你选择安装路径

    默认情况下,`bin`文件夹位于安装目录下的`bin`子文件夹中

    例如,如果你在Windows系统上选择将MySQL安装在`C:Program FilesMySQLMySQL Server8.0`,那么`bin`文件夹的位置就是`C:Program FilesMySQLMySQL Server8.0bin`

     2. 第三方软件包管理器 在Linux系统上,使用APT(Debian/Ubuntu)或YUM(CentOS/RHEL)等软件包管理器安装MySQL是一种常见的做法

    这种情况下,MySQL的可执行文件通常会被放置在系统的标准路径中,如`/usr/bin`或`/usr/sbin`

    这意味着,虽然你可能不会看到一个单独的`bin`文件夹在MySQL的安装目录下,但MySQL的命令已经可以直接在命令行中访问

     3. ZIP压缩包安装 对于需要从源代码编译或需要自定义安装路径的用户,下载MySQL的ZIP压缩包是一个选择

    解压后,你需要手动配置环境变量或创建符号链接,以便能够方便地访问`bin`文件夹中的可执行文件

    在这种情况下,`bin`文件夹的位置完全取决于你解压ZIP文件的位置

     三、查找`bin`文件夹的实用方法 如果你已经安装了MySQL,但不确定`bin`文件夹的位置,以下是一些实用的查找方法

     1. 检查安装日志 如果你在安装过程中留意了安装日志,通常可以在日志中找到安装路径的信息

    这对于通过安装向导或命令行脚本安装MySQL的用户特别有用

     2. 使用系统搜索功能 在Windows上,你可以使用文件资源管理器的搜索功能,搜索`mysqld.exe`或`mysql.exe`,这些文件通常位于`bin`文件夹中

    在Linux上,可以使用`find`命令,如`find / -name mysqld`,来搜索整个文件系统(注意,这可能需要超级用户权限,并且会花费一些时间)

     3. 检查环境变量 如果你已经配置好了MySQL的环境变量,可以直接在命令行中输入`mysql --version`或`mysqld --version`

    系统会显示MySQL的版本信息,同时也会在输出中显示可执行文件的路径

     4. 查看MySQL配置文件 MySQL的配置文件(如`my.cnf`或`my.ini`)中,有时也会包含安装路径的信息

    虽然这不是直接指向`bin`文件夹的方法,但可以帮助你定位MySQL的整体安装结构

     四、解决常见问题 在寻找`bin`文件夹的过程中,你可能会遇到一些常见问题

    以下是一些解决方案

     1.权限问题 在Linux系统上,如果你无法访问某个目录,可能是因为权限不足

    尝试使用`sudo`命令提升权限,或者修改目录的权限设置

     2. 安装路径被更改 如果你在安装过程中自定义了安装路径,但后来忘记了,可以尝试回顾安装过程中的步骤或查看任何相关的安装文档

     3.安装了错误的版本 有时,下载并安装的可能是MySQL的一个非标准版本(如仅包含客户端工具的版本)

    确保你下载的是完整的MySQL服务器安装包

     4. 环境变量未配置 在Windows上,如果`bin`文件夹中的可执行文件无法直接在命令行中访问,可能是因为环境变量未正确配置

    你需要将`bin`文件夹的路径添加到系统的`PATH`环境变量中

     五、最佳实践 为了避免将来再次遇到找不到`bin`文件夹的问题,以下是一些最佳实践建议

     -记录安装路径:在安装MySQL时,务必记录安装路径

    这可以通过截图、保存安装日志或简单地在文本文件中记录来实现

     -配置环境变量:在Windows上,将MySQL的`bin`文件夹添加到系统的`PATH`环境变量中,可以方便地在任何位置访问MySQL命令

     -使用版本管理工具:对于需要在多个环境中部署MySQL的开发团队,考虑使用版本管理工具(如Docker、Vagrant)来确保环境的一致性

     -定期检查更新:MySQL经常发布更新,包含重要的安全修复和功能改进

    定期检查并更新你的MySQL版本,可以确保系统的安全性和稳定性

     结语 找不到MySQL的`bin`文件夹可能会让人感到沮丧,但只要你理解了MySQL的安装结构,掌握了正确的查找方法,这个问题并不难解决

    通过遵循本文提供的指南,你可以迅速定位`bin`文件夹,确保能够顺利地使用MySQL的各种功能

    记住,记录安装路径、配置环境变量和定期检查更新是避免未来问题的关键

    希望这篇文章能帮助你解决困惑,让你在MySQL的使用之路上更加顺畅!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道